Lobby hours are 8:30 a.m. to 4:30 p.m., Monday through Friday. No Glass: While glass is recyclable and the City does recycle glass; glass cannot be placed into your blue recycling cart. Broken glass causes both safety and contamination issues. Please take glass to any of the City's FREE drop-off locations to be recycled properly. Have information available … Depending on space availability, complexes are provided with 6-yard lift bins or 96-gallon recycle carts. The City of Albuquerque has created an MFD Recycling Toolkit for property managers and owners to assist them in educating their tenants on recycling best practices. To request a toolkit please call 505-761-8167. The Solid Waste Management Department (SWMD), Parks and Recreation, and PNM are teaming up to offer residents a chance to recycle their real Christmas trees. The program kicks off on December 26, 2022, and runs through January 8, 2023, at three separate locations in Albuquerque. No artificial trees will be accepted.December 18, 2023.
